    Numerical solutions of a class of second order boundary value problems on using Bernoulli Polynomials

    Full text link
    The aim of this paper is to find the numerical solutions of the second order linear and nonlinear differential equations with Dirichlet, Neumann and Robin boundary conditions. We use the Bernoulli polynomials as linear combination to the approximate solutions of 2nd order boundary value problems. Here the Bernoulli polynomials over the interval [0, 1] are chosen as trial functions so that care has been taken to satisfy the corresponding homogeneous form of the Dirichlet boundary conditions in the Galerkin weighted residual method. In addition to that the given differential equation over arbitrary finite domain [a, b] and the boundary conditions are converted into its equivalent form over the interval [0, 1]. All the formulas are verified by considering numerical examples. The approximate solutions are compared with the exact solutions, and also with the solutions of the existing methods. A reliable good accuracy is obtained in all cases.Comment: 6 table

    Novel nonalloyed thermally stable Pd/Sn and Pd/Sn/Au ohmic contacts for the fabrication of GaAs MESFETs

    Get PDF
    GaAs metal-semiconductor field-effect transistors (MESFETs) have been fabricated utilizing thermally stable Pd/Sn and Pd/Sn/Au ohmic contacts for the first time. MESFETs with Pd/Ge ohmic contacts are fabricated for comparison. The thermal stability of the Pd/Sn, Pd/Ge and Pd/Sn/Au ohmic contacts is also presente

    Study on Impact of Development Works or Edge Effect to the Floral Diversity of Dhanmondi Lake, Dhaka, Bangladesh

    Get PDF
    The study was conducted over a period of one month concentrated Dhanmondi Lake, Dhanmondi, Dhaka.The study also focused on impact on development works and edge effect to the floral diversity & micro climate in Dhanmondi Lake. The duration of the sunlight almost 14 hours daylight during the study period and there was little variation in temperature near and 10meter distance from path ways.  Only 0.7 (º C) differences were observed at 10cm below the ground inside the lake. Quadrats that were away from the path had a higher DS value demonstrating lower floral diversity compared to that of the quadrats near the path. Results revealed that the Ds value near to pathway was 0.2608 and 0.7481 for 10 meter distance for all species from the pathway

    Alternative Energy Sources for Energy Crisis: Rethinking the Global and Bangladesh Perspectives

    Get PDF
    This paper discusses the evolution of various energy resources, their reserves, and usages for policy makers and energy experts. It finds that there is a huge supply-side deficit to meet the demand of the 7 billion people in today's world. To meet this huge energy needs, alternative energy sources are investigated and suggestions are made to address energy crises in Bangladesh and global contexts. The author argues that with the advancement of technology, a completely new nuclear meaning thorium reactors, small modular reactors, and novel solar technologies can offer potential alternatives to meet the needs of mankind. In addition, developing cost-effective carbon capture storage devices to catch carbon at its generating sources, energy storage devices, and energy culture model can be explored. The search for alternative technologies and energy culture require robust discussion, cooperation, and investment in clean energy sources. The paper concludes with a discussion of future energy policy and appropriate action plans to adopt emerging alternative technologies as per the promises made at the Paris Climate Change Accord COP21

    Economic Service Life of RC Structure Based on Corrosion Initiation Time

    Get PDF
    Target service life of the structure specified by the codes and standards for RC infrastructures has failed to achieve due to uncertainties at the time of construction of structure and at exposure to real environment. Moreover, the more resistivity of the cover concrete, the larger is the service life and thus higher is the cost incurred by the owner. Therefore, economic service life (ESL) has more value than considering engineering service life, where both the failure and the cost consider parallel in the prediction of service life.A statistical model to determine the time to initiate corrosion due to chloride attack to the RC member and subsequent repair considering all costs incorporated is taken into account in this research. Cost minimization model is used to calculate economic service life where initial cost, repair cost and gain from revenue for the structure are paid attention. Further, a correlation between corrosion initiation time (CIT) and economic service life (ESL) is proposed
